fix: add dtype guard to FlashAttnBackend capability check

- _backend_supports now rejects fp32 for FlashAttnBackend (flash-attn only supports fp16/bf16), preventing runtime crash on fallback chain
- rename test_default_backend_is_torch_native to reflect multi-backend reality
- scheduler test fixture uses bf16 model (matches production, avoids unnecessary 3-step fallback chain)
